Synaptic Terminals
The extremities of axons that make synaptic connections with other neurons, releasing neurotransmitters to transmit nerve impulses.
Resting Potential
Resting potential is the electrical difference across the neuronal membrane when the neuron is not actively sending a signal, typically around -70 millivolts.
Neurotransmitters
Substances that carry messages through a chemical synapse from one neuron to another neuron, muscle, or gland cell, facilitating signal transmission.
Natural Selection
The process by which biological traits become either more or less common in a population as a function of the reproduction and survival of their bearers.
